This 5 1/2yr old giant we called junk , do to all the character and points. He always came to drink at this water barrel every few days until the rut started. Never came out during daylight during season. Was always by himself or a small buck in pictures and hunting in past years. These are last pictures I got of him coming to get a drink. Our neighbor and family friend ended up shooting him a few weeks later after this picture was taken during the rut cruising by himself. He ended up gross scoring 192inches had 17pts and was 18in wide
